Born to Be Bad is the seventh studio album released by George Thorogood. It was released in 1988 on the EMI label. The album peaked at #32 on the Billboard 200, and was on the charts for 24 weeks. The album is unabashedly a party-hearty serving of Chicago blues (a convincing version of Howlin' Wolf' "Highway 49"), rockabilly (a smart revamp of Chuck Berry's "You Can't Catch Me"), '60s R&B (Roy Head's horn-driven "Treat Her Right"), country (Hank Snow's often covered "I'm Movin' On"), and more. 180 gram vinyl with download codes.
